Very weird. Different member names, but same crude in the middle. Any clues, thanks!!

 
 sthoemke
 
posted on September 5, 2007 01:52:56 PM new
Just a spammer with lousey programming skills. Just subsitute every "mn" with a space and you get:

We are a large wholesaler for selling electrical products , an agent of all the well-known digital products manufacturers , and facing to wholesalers worldwide . We have our own warehouse and stores , We export all kinds of digital products , and offer competitive , attractive price and good quality , so you can make a big profite . We have been received very high praise from our customers all over the world in the past few years .
